
I went to see U2 3D at Imax on Wednesday night, and it was definitely worth seeing!
The screen is huge and the images on screen are 10 times larger than traditional cinema format, while also being in 3D format. The film was a recording of U2 playing in a live stadium in South America on their 'Vertigo' Tour.
The experience was amazing, it is almost like you are actually at the concert. The band members on stage feel as if they are just metres away from you, the whole atmosphere felt so realistic.
To U2's credit, they also played a great live event! Which is probably one of the reasons why they are one of the biggest bands in the world..
